Effective Sample Letter Writing Guide

Crafting compelling and impactful letters is a valuable skill. Whether persuade, inform, or appeal, a well-structured letter can make a significant difference.

Start by clarifying your goal. What do you want to attain with this letter? Once you have a clear understanding of your intentions, outline your thoughts into logical paragraphs.

Each paragraph should focus on a distinct point, supporting the overall message.

Use a professional tone throughout the letter. Welcome the recipient by name and use appropriate salutations. Ensure brevity in your writing, avoiding unnecessary jargon or technicalities. Review your letter carefully for any errors before sending it. A polished and error-free letter conveys professionalism and attention to detail.

  • Utilize strong call-to-action statements to guide the reader toward a desired outcome.
  • Supplement relevant documents or attachments as necessary.
  • Summarize your key points in a concise closing paragraph.

Types of Sample Letters and Their Uses

Sample letters are vital tools for sharing information in a variety of professional and personal situations. They serve as examples that can be adapted to fit specific needs. There are numerous classifications of sample letters, each with its own function.

  • Formal Letters: These letters maintain a professional tone and are typically used for communication with individuals or organizations in business contexts.
  • Informal Letters: In contrast to formal letters, informal letters adopt a more casual style. They are often used to communicate with friends and family.
  • Cover Letters: These letters present your skills to potential recruiters when applying for a job.
  • Complaint Letters: Used to voice dissatisfaction with a product, service, or situation, complaint letters aim to fix the issue.
